今天给各位分享服务器jdbc的知识,其中也会对服务器租用进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
JDBC是JavaDatabaseConnectivity的缩写,是JavaAPI中用于访问数据库并实行SQL语句的一组类和接口。它答应Java应用程序开辟职员毗连数据库,并通过java程序查找数据库驱动来实现数据库毗连。
利用JDBC常常导致大量的重复代码,取得毗连、创建语句、处理惩罚结果集,然后关闭毗连。Spring的JDBC和DAO模块抽取了这些重复代码,因此你可以保持你的数据库访问代码干净简便,而且可以防止因关闭数据库资源失败而引起的题目。这个模块还在几种数据库服务器给出的错误消息之上创建了一个故意义的非常层。
1、起首,保举利用Thin驱动程序,而不是OCI驱动程序。Thin驱动程序是纯Java驱动,与数据库直接通讯,测试表明其通常优于OCI驱动程序在客户端软件开辟中的性能。其次,关闭主动提交功能。在创建数据库毗连时,默认环境下处于主动提交模式。通过调用Connection类的setAutoCommit()方法,将此设置为false,可以进步性能。
2、末了,充实利用SQL的面向聚集方法举行数据库操纵,以镌汰复杂的编程逻辑和进步代码服从。比方,通过多列子查询和set子句实现批量更新,简化数据处理惩罚流程。
3、MySQL具有很多可调解的参数,利用精确的参数设置可以充实利用服务器的硬件资源,进步数据库的服从和性能。
4、缓存机制在利用MyBatis时,缓存机制扮演了关键脚色。它分为一级缓存和二级缓存。一级缓存是基于SQLSession的,而二级缓存则是基于Mapper级别的。二级缓存答应跨SQLSession共享数据,明显进步了查询性能,镌汰了不须要的数据库访问。
1、:1类驱动。这就是JDBC-ODBC桥的方式。但这种方式不得当程序的重用与维护,不保举利用。必要数据库的ODBC驱动。2:2类驱动。这就是JDBC+厂商API的情势。厂商API一样平常利用C编写,以是,这种方式也不长利用。3:3类驱动。这就是JDBC+厂商DatabaseConnectionServer+DataBase的情势。
2、第三种方法是设置毗连不答应主动提交数据,从而优化批量插入服从。
3、Driver接口是全部JDBC驱动必要实现的接口,用于数据库厂商提供实现。程序无需直接调用Driver实现类,由DriverManager类调用,负责管理驱动程序。加载驱动利用Class类静态方法forName(),转达驱动类名。
4、简述JDBC提供的毗连数据库的几种方法。1)与数据源直接通讯:利用JDBC和数据库已订定的协议时,可利用一个驱动程序直接与数据源通讯。既可以创建本身的驱动程序,也可找一个公用的。
服务器jdbc的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于服务器租用、服务器jdbc的信息别忘了在本站进行查找喔。
我要评论